Output e371451948944d67b6d2f500fe4a64ee508d78e98d91b8b2a9f33cccf6a87ca7:6

value
3016985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3412bab77e6a8481dd55e3f80aaae6c71b6cafc OP_EQUAL
address
3NQdPDmMeoWZd67P58rmznfJTwDh3va567
transaction
e371451948944d67b6d2f500fe4a64ee508d78e98d91b8b2a9f33cccf6a87ca7
spent
true